The Cosa Nostra Klub (often abbreviated as The CNK) is a French black metal/industrial metal band, founded in Clermont-Ferrand, (France) in 1996 by Mr Hreidmarr (former singer of Anorexia Nervosa) and Mr Heinrich Von B. The band has changed their name three times: Count Nosferatu, Count Nosferatu Kommando and in 2006 it has been renamed The Cosa Nostra Klub.

History

1996–2002

The band started as a raw black metal group, then named Count Nosferatu. They were a teenage band consisting of five members. They separated in 1998.

2002-2005

After joining Anorexia Nervosa in 1998, Hreidmarr focused on his new group and put The CNK on hold. They waited 4 years before a new album was released, Ultraviolence Über Alles, in 2002. This new album is described as a mix of guitars, guns and war machines, to create a massive and violent sound. The band had only one rule: to go beyond the limits, using as many effects as needed to create a completely new sound, very machine-like. Unfortunately, the band did not have a solid formation and was therefore unable to play their new album live.

2005-Present

On the 20th of December 2005, Hreidmarr departed from Anorexia Nervosa. Even though he was still working on The CNK during his free time with Heinrich, things speed up after Hreidmarr's departure. The duo recruited Sylvicious of Tamtrum and the (in)famous parisian designer Valnoir of Metastazis. Their new album would have a very different sound than their first album as they would use a completely new way of creating an album. Instead of starting off with guitar riffs and drum beats, they used remixed samples of classical music from various composers, such as Beethoven, Orff, Prokofiev and Tchaïkovski. "The CNK dream team is now complete and ready to grind, raze, crush, and piss you off with an incredibly heavy opus of Wagner-like and anti-politically correct electro-metal. Entitled "L'Hymne à la Joie", the band's second album is produced by Stefan Bayle (ANOREXIA NERVOSA), and sounds like Carl Orff drinking Martini with Rammstein and Alec Empire, sitting together on a heap of human corpses, rambling on the death of our modern world."[1]

The album was very well received by the public and the band began touring on April 11, 2008, playing songs from both albums. They are currently working on a reedition of Ultraviolence Über Alles, which is now sold-out, a video and a third opus. They hinted that this new album would not use classical samples and would be more tragic than the other two.[2] On November 13, a statement was made on their Myspace that drummer Sylvicious was replaced by Fabrizzio Volponi (Antaeus, Horrid Flesh), due to the busy schedule of both Tamtrum and The CNK.[3] On November 16 the band will re-release a remaster version of their debut album. Discography

  • Das Schwarze Order (demo - 1996)
  • Soleil Noir (demo - 1998)
  • Ultraviolence Über Alles (2002)
  • L'Hymne à la Joie (2007)
  • Ultraviolence Über Alles - Übercharged Edition (2009)

Members

  • Mr Heinrich Von B (Jean-Sébastien Ogilvy : guitar, vocals)
  • Mr Hreidmarr (Nicolas St Morand : vocals, former-Anorexia Nervosa as Rose Hreidmarr,[4] former-Crack ov Dawn, former-Malveliance, former-My Darkest Dream)
  • Mr Valnoir (Jean-Emmanuel Artfield-Lautrec : bass, vocals) (Metastazis)
  • Fabrizzio Volponi (aka HDK : drums, former drummer of Antaeus)

Former members

  • Mr Sylvicious (drums) (Tamtrum)
  • Grafin Orlock (keyboards)
  • Melissa De Sainte Croix (Melissa DSC) (bass)
  • Doktor Holocausto (drums)
  • Athevros (guitars)
  • Sir Orias (bass)
  • Morbus Gravis (bass)
  • Lord Sidragazum (drums)
